Drainage pipe materials should be selected based on local conditions according to factors such as drainage properties, composition, temperature, groundwater erosion, external load, soil conditions, and construction conditions. When conditions permit, underground plastic drainage pipes should be prioritized. The following selection guidelines should be followed: For gravity flow drainage pipes, underground plastic pipes, concrete pipes, or reinforced concrete pipes should be chosen; drainage pipes leading to community sewage treatment facilities should use plastic drainage pipes; for special sections crossing ditches, rivers, etc., or pressurized pipe sections, steel pipes or cast iron pipes can be used. If plastic pipes are used, a metal casing should be added (the casing diameter should be 200mm larger than the outer diameter of the plastic pipe); when the drainage temperature exceeds 40 degrees, metal drainage pipes or high-temperature resistant plastic pipes should be used; pipes for transporting corrosive sewage can use plastic pipes; plastic drainage pipes under roads and driveways should have a circumferential bending stiffness of not less than 8kN/m², while those under non-driveway areas in communities and other locations should have a circumferential bending stiffness of not less than 4kN/m².
2. Indoor drainage pipes in buildings should use construction drainage plastic pipes and fittings or flexible joint ductile iron pipes and corresponding fittings.
3. In environments where the temperature may drop below 0 degrees, metal drainage pipes should be used; drainage pipes with continuous or frequent drainage temperatures greater than 40 degrees or instantaneous drainage temperatures greater than 80 degrees, such as wastewater drainage systems in public baths, hotels with hot water supply systems, drainage pipes for high-temperature drainage equipment, and drainage horizontal branches and main pipes in public building kitchens, should use metal drainage pipes or heat-resistant plastic drainage pipes.
4. Pressure drainage pipes can use pressure-resistant plastic pipes, metal pipes, or coated composite steel pipes.
5. For buildings with high construction standards or quiet environments, if the noise of water flow in ordinary plastic drainage pipes cannot meet noise control requirements, appropriate sound insulation measures should be taken, such as using specially designed sound-absorbing pipe materials and fittings, using sound-insulating wall structures (solid walls, lightweight partition walls, sound-insulating walls filled with foam plastic, etc.), installing rubber pads on pipe brackets, wrapping sound-absorbing insulating materials around the pipe walls where they pass through floors, setting up vent pipes for fixtures, etc.
6. When selecting plastic drainage pipes for laboratory buildings, teaching buildings, or hospitals that discharge acidic or alkaline wastewater, attention should be paid to the corrosion of wastewater's acidity, alkalinity, and chemical composition on the plastic pipe materials and joint materials.
7. In high-rise buildings with heights exceeding 100 meters, drainage pipes should use flexible joint ductile iron pipes and their fittings.
8. Vent pipes can use plastic pipes and flexible joint ductile iron pipes.
9. Connection methods: (1) For UPVC, CPVC, SNA+PVC pipes and fittings, it is advisable to use matched adhesives for socket bonding. Vertical pipes can also use elastic sealing rings for connection.

Are there any requirements for the installation construction of PVC pipes? Proper installation of PVC pipes ensures smooth water flow without issues such as blockage. Additionally, aesthetic considerations are also important, so the installation and laying of PVC drainage pipes require various methods and skills. Below, the PVC pipe manufacturer shares the installation requirements and specifications.
1. The fusion joints of electric fusion fittings and pipes must not be wet.
2. The connection surfaces of the pipes and fittings must be dry, clean, and oil-free.
3. The cut ends of the pipes must be perpendicular to the pipe axis. Pipe cutting is generally done with pipe scissors or pipe cutting machines; if necessary, a sharp hacksaw can be used, but the cut surface must be free of burrs and sharp edges.
4. The hot melting tool should be powered on and allowed to reach working temperature (indicated by a green light) before beginning operations.
5. During heating, the pipe end should be inserted into the heating sleeve without rotation, pushed to the marked depth, and simultaneously, the fitting should be pushed onto the heating head, reaching the specified marked point. Heating times should follow the instructions in the welding tool manual.
6. After reaching the heating time, the pipe and fitting should be removed from the heating mold simultaneously and inserted straight and evenly into the marked depth without rotation, forming a uniform flange at the joint.
7. Within the specified time, the freshly welded joint can still be adjusted, but it must not be rotated.
8. When welding elbows or tees, attention should be paid to their direction according to the design drawings, and positions should be marked on the straight direction of the fitting and pipe.
9. The standard heating time for electric fusion connections should be provided by the manufacturer and should be adjusted according to environmental temperatures.
10. Pipes should not be bent during installation. When passing through walls or floors, forced corrections should not be made, and when laying with other metal pipes, the clearance should be greater than 100mm, with polypropylene pipes placed on the inner side of metal pipes.
11. Exposed indoor pipes should be installed after the civil construction is completed, and proper pre-reserved holes should be made in conjunction with civil construction, with dimensions preferably exceeding the outer diameter of the pipe by 50mm. Steel casings should be set up when pipes pass through floors, with the casing protruding 50mm above the floor (ground) surface.
12. Strict waterproof measures should be taken when pipes pass through floors or roofs, with fixed supports set on both sides of the penetration point.
13. For pipes buried beneath floor finishes and within walls, water pressure tests and acceptance records for concealed works should be conducted.
14. When pipes pass through foundation walls, metal casings should be installed to ensure a secure installation.
PVC Pipe Specifications Introduction
PVC can be divided into soft PVC and hard PVC. Hard PVC accounts for about two-thirds of the market, while soft PVC accounts for one-third. Soft PVC is generally used for flooring, ceilings, and as the surface layer of leather, but due to the presence of plasticizers (which differentiate it from hard PVC), it is prone to brittleness and difficult to preserve, limiting its usage range. Hard PVC does not contain plasticizers, thus maintaining good flexibility, easy molding, and is not prone to brittleness. It is non-toxic, non-polluting, and has a long shelf life, making it highly valuable for development and application.
PVC has poor combustion performance, extinguishing when removed from the flame, and is classified as a flame-retardant plastic. Additionally, it has good electrical insulation properties, suitable for protective casings for wires and cables. PVC pipes exhibit high resistance to water pressure, external pressure, and impact strength, making them suitable for various piping projects, with applications being extremely broad.

Factors Influencing PE Pipe Prices
1. From the perspective of PE pipes themselves, the raw materials are a decisive factor in pipe pricing. Some PE pipe manufacturers reduce costs by using recycled materials as raw materials. These materials may not meet pressure standards, may not have the required tensile lengths, and especially do not meet hygiene standards. Furthermore, pipes made from recycled materials may have rough inner walls and contain impurities. While the cost of such pipes is reduced, their quality is significantly affected. Therefore, when purchasing PE pipes, it is crucial to understand market conditions and avoid buying overly cheap pipes.
2. From the perspective of PE pipe types and specifications, the uses of PE pipes are quite broad, including water supply pipes, conduit pipes, and corrugated pipes. Each of these types has differences in structure, process, and performance, leading to cost differences. People should determine price levels based on specific pipe types. Furthermore, differences in pipe diameters, wall thickness, and lengths result in varying material usage amounts, expenditures, etc., which also affect PE pipe prices.

PE pipes are mainly applied in urban water supply networks, irrigation water diversion projects, and agricultural sprinkler irrigation projects. Since the connection of the pipes uses hot melt and electric fusion methods, they achieve integration between the joints and the pipes, effectively resisting the axial stresses generated by internal pressure and impact stresses. Moreover, no heavy metal salt stabilizers are added during production, making the material non-toxic, non-scaling, and non-bacterial, thus avoiding secondary pollution of drinking water.
PE pipes are available in medium-density polyethylene and high-density polyethylene. They are categorized into SDR11 and SDR17.6 series based on wall thickness. The former is suitable for transporting gaseous artificial coal gas, natural gas, and liquefied petroleum gas, while the latter is primarily for natural gas transportation. Compared to steel pipes, they offer simpler construction processes and certain flexibility; moreover, they do not require anti-corrosion treatments, saving a significant number of processes. Their drawback is that they are mechanically not as robust as steel pipes, necessitating special attention to safety clearance during heating supply installations, and they should not be exposed to air or sunlight, as well as being sensitive to chemical substances to prevent damages from leaking sewage pipes.
